Item: CA-Psychosocial Services-30
Probability of Having Received a Type of Service among
Participants at Medical and Psychosocial Projects Pattern Based on Length of Service Episode
This Knowledge Item illustrates the
difference between participants at Medical and Psychosocial service
providers
in terms of the likelihood that a patient will have received at least
one unit of a type of service after a given number of days in the
program. These charts illustrate the difference between these medical
providers, all of whom are providing "integrated" care for
their patients, and the psychosocial service providers, all of whom
are linking their clients to medical providers. Of particular
importance, the psychosocial service providers integrate substance
abuse services directly into their programs.
